▎ 摘  要

NOVELTY - The method involves mixing contaminated soil with a conductive additive to form a mixture, where the contaminated soil comprises pollutants. A voltage is applied across the mixture, where the voltage is applied in voltage pulses, duration of the pulses is for a duration period and the application of the voltage across the mixture decomposes and removes the pollutants from the contaminated soil to form remediated soil. The pollutants are organic pollutants, metals, metalloids, heavy metals, toxic heavy metal, rare earth metal, main group metal, or transition metal. The organic pollutants are converted to flash graphene. USE - Method for performing soil remediation by flash Joule heating (FJH) in a belt-fed process, in an autonomous process and in a continuous process. ADVANTAGE - The method enables to remediate contaminated soil, which is capable of removing heavy metals from the contaminated soil in an economical manner, and does not require the use of solvents or expensive chemicals, and provides stable and non-toxic form of carbon, and effectively removes heavy metals in contaminated soils.
